GREYMOUTH TROTTING MEETING OPENS. Per Press Association. GREYMOUTH, January 5. The Greymouth Trotting Club’s meeting opened in splendid weather. There was a large attendance. The track was in good order. Results:— GUINNESS HANDICAP, Of 125 sovs. One mile and a half and 110 3’ards. 1— Acliray, scr 1 2 Audrey Dillon, scr 2 11—Connie Dillon, scr 3 Scratched: Trespass, Val Logan, Bonalena, Bonnie Prince, and Direct Wave. Won by half a length. Time —3min 44 4-ssec. EXPRESS HANDICAP. (In Harness). Of 125 sovs; one mile and a-half and 110 yards. 2—Connie Audubon, scr * I —Great Elect, 72yds bhd .... * s—Nellie Hugo, 96yds bhd .... 3 * Dead heat. All started. Time—otnin 52 4-ssec A protest against Great Elect for boring was upheld and the race was awarded to Connie Audubon. M. B. Edwards, driver of Great Elect, was fined £lO and cautioned. ELECTRIC HANDICAP (in saddle). Of 125 sovs. One mile and 110 j'ards. 9—Velocity, 24yds bhd 1 s—Sedmere, 24yds bhd 2 7—JCelburn, scr 3 Scratched: Tiny Huon, Dahlia Dillon, Bertha Bingen. Won by a. length. Time—2min 32 2-oscc.
